Across TCGA patient cohorts, MYOD1 protein abundance is significantly associated with the RNA expression of many other genes, with 476 significant associations in total. GBM shows the largest number of these associations.

The most reproducible MYOD1-associated genes across cancer lineages are CRYBB3, ETV7, and APOL1. Each is linked with MYOD1 in more than 1 cancer types. Because this analysis shows association rather than direction, both MYOD1-to-partner and partner-to-MYOD1 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, MYOD1 versus CRYBB3 in GBM, with a Pearson correlation of -0.37.
